Improved CRC32Map checking in several ways:
- servers now compute the map in a separate thread - CRC32Maps are kept in cache for 30 mins - CRC32Maps requests cannot be used to overflood a server anymore since their number is limited. - Transfer modules now send keep alive packets to maintain tunnels when asking for a CRC32Map git-svn-id: http://svn.code.sf.net/p/retroshare/code/trunk@4661 b45a01b8-16f6-495d-af2f-9b41ad6348cc
